Why am I bearish? As banks modernize and embrace instanteous transaction methods (ie Zelle),

the financial role Crypto can play is diminished in importance. There are other roles for Crypto in our digital universe, like ownership of digital art, which is in play (ie $ETH.X and NFTs),

but crypto as a means of ‘instantaneous financial transactions’ is losing its importance as banks modernize and as the US clamps down on anonymous crypto transactions.

Remember: when Bitcoin was created, it was much more different to send money instantaneously. It was a different world then.

I’m not bearish on crypto overall, as there are other uses for it, particularly in regards to persevering and authenticating ownership of art (which I like).

But Bitcoin? We simply don’t need it.
